There were actually two versions of the Klass trademarks. The regular sized one and a smaller version.
Same for Eickhorn. They first used the large trademark them went to the small double oval mark. If you are counting smooth tail and serrated, that make four versions.
As for the Kober, what is hard to see in that photo is that there is the remnants of that horizontal stroke Rohm used.
